Allegation: Resident eloped from the facility due to lack of staff supervision.
It was alleged that facility staff failed to provide adequate supervision, which resulted in Client #1 (C1) eloping from the facility on 08/22/2025. To investigate this allegation, on 09/02/2025, LPA conducted interviews with the Administrator, Staff #1 (S1), Staff #2 (S2), and one (1) out of three (3) clients who were available. During a subsequent visit, LPA conducted interviews with three (3) out of four (4) clients who were available. During the 09/02/2025 interview with one (1) client, LPA was informed that he/she was able to tape the inside window alarm, exit the facility, walk to local stores, and return later that night. Both S1 and S2 reported they were on duty, remained awake, conducted hourly checks, and observed all clients, including C1, in their bedrooms throughout the night, and both staff and the Administrator confirmed that alarms were functioning. Lastly, interviews with three (3) clients on 02/09/2026 revealed they did not witness C1 leave, did not hear alarms, and reported staff presence overnight. Review of C1’s Individual Service Plan documented a history of false allegations and fabrication of stories. Based on interviews and documentation, this allegation is Unsubstantiated at this time.
